Louisiana Could Become National Leader in Protecting Citizens From Unreasonable Force Danae Columbus - Contributing Writer May 14th 2021 The police reform movement in Louisiana won a major victory this week when HB 609 by Rep. Edmond Jordan was passed out of the Louisiana House of Representatives with 53 votes, the exact number needed for passage. The bill will next be debated by the Senate Judiciary B committee.
